SET OF VINTAGE TOLE LIDDED JARS

A matching set of gold-painted tin storage canisters on their original wall-mounted shelf.

Seven canisters in total, each one labelled in black type, ‘Tea, Coffee, Currants, Sultanas, Rice, Flour and Sugar’.

Probably dating from the early 20th century, circa 1920s in date.

This particular set doesn’t have a maker’s mark present; similar shelving units were marked, but we believe these to be later examples, dating from the 1930s-1950s. After doing a bit of research, this earlier set could quite possibly be by Orme Evans & Co. Ltd of Wolverhampton. We have matched this particular canister shape to their catalogues dating from the 1920s.

Overall, the set is in good vintage order. There is wear throughout commensurate with age/use. There is a naturally built-up patina from years in a kitchen, which we think adds to its charm and aesthetic, so we have left them like this, but they could quite possibly be cleaned if that is a preference.

Approximate measurements:

Shelf overall - 61cm high x 48cm wide x 17cm deep.

Largest canister (Flour) - 23cm high x 13cm diameter.

Medium-sized canisters (Rice and Sugar) - 18cm high x 17cm diameter.

Smallest canisters (Tea, Coffee, Currants and Sultanas) - 15cm high x 11cm diameter.
